Abstract
Michael Mann will review the scientific evidence on climate change, the reasons why we should care, and the often absurd efforts undertaken by special interests and partisan political figures to confuse the public, attack the science and scientists, and deny that the problem even exists. Despite the monumental nature of the challenge we face, particularly after the Paris Agreement, Prof. Mann will explain why he’s cautiously optimistic that reason and science will prevail in the greatest battle that human civilization has possibly ever faced - the battle to avert catastrophic and irreversible climate change impacts.Event organized by Stefano Caserini and Renato Casagrandi (www.iat.polimi.it) with the support of Campus Sostenibile, RSE- Ricerca sul Sistema Energetico, Fondazione Politecnico, CMCC, Radio Popolare, Climate-Lab and the Italian Association of Environmental and Land Planning Engineers
